In addition to the slew of devices launched earlier, Alcatel also announced the local availability of its Idol S Mini 2. It sports a 4.5-inch display with quad-core processor and LTE connectivity.
Alcatel Idol S Mini 2 specs:
4.5-inch IPS LCD display @ 960 x 540 resolution, 245ppi
1.2GHz quad-core processor
1GB RAM
4GB/8GB storage
Up to 32GB via microSD
8MP rear camera with LED flash
1080p video @ 30fps
2MP front camera
Bluetooth 4.0, A2DP
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n, Wi-Fi hotspot
GPS, A-GPS
3G, LTE
2000mAh battery
Android 4.4 KitKat
The Idol S Mini 2 is priced at Php11,999 and comes in a variety of colors.
